Posted by Jay on Jan 12th 2026
First of all I'm about 6'1", and weigh 170. I bought two coats, one medium and one large tall. My shoulders are about 42" and I could barely get the medium on. Since I have long arms, the Large tall fits almost perfectly. It is a little roomy in the body section but bulky clothes are worn under it. I will say it's not heavy enough for me to wear when it's 20 degrees or below. But it's a beautiful coat. One other thing, be very patient getting your money back after a return. Since I bought two coats, I had to return one and it took about a month to get my money back.

Posted by Paul on Sep 21st 2025
What’s the difference between the $300 Mackinaw and the $400 Mackinaw? I just bought the $300 Mackinaw and I love it! ~ Hi Paul, Our double mackinaw has an additional layer on top of the coat for extra warmth. SK~
